Latest Patents

Among Peter Andresen's latest inventions are two notable patents. The first patent, titled "Method for determining the spatial concentration of the components of a gas mixture in a combustion chamber," describes an advanced technique for measuring the concentration of gas components during combustion processes. This method employs a laser beam directed into the combustion chamber that causes particles to radiate, with the resultant light being captured and analyzed through a specialized imaging system.

The second patent, "Beam splitter device," provides a sophisticated method for splitting and reflecting laser beams in laser scanning microscopy. This invention outlines a detailed process that involves using partially reflecting mirrors and high reflectivity mirrors to manipulate laser beams for improved analysis of samples.
